Q: Β  What is the cutoff for CSE at RGPV?
A: 

RGPV cutoff for the BTech CER course is based on JEE Main ranks followed by the JEE Main Counselling. As per the RGPV cutoff 2023, the Round 1 closing rank for BTech CSE stood closed at 122582 for the General All India category students.

Tabulated below are the Round 1 and the Last Round closing ranks BTech CSE offered at the RGPV for the General All India category candidates:

CourseR1 (Closing Rank)Last Round (Closing Rank)
B.Tech. in Computer Science and Engineering122582197409

Q: Β  What is the cost for RGPV MBA course?
A: 

The total tuition fee for a two year MBA course ranges between INR 78,000 - INR 1.5 lakh. This fee is includes the fee for all affiliated colleges of RGPV that offers MBA course.  Apart from this, candidates also have to pay for hostel charges, if they apply for accomodation. Candidates also have to pay for other one-time charges such as Refundable Caution Money, Exam Development Fee, Prospectus Fee, etc.

Decent college with average placement and its tuition feels
Placements: About 60 to 80 percent of students are placed each year. This year the highest package was around 50 LPA in Palo Alto (off-campus) and approximately 20 LPA (on-campus). Most tech companies came every year like Capgemini, Infosys, TCS, HCL, Wipro, SAP, EY, Uber, KPIT, etc.
Infrastructure: Classrooms are good, with some of them having smart classes. Labs are also good, all the equipment needed is available here. The library is also good, all the books you need for your preparation are available. At the hostel, there are 6-seater rooms and 2-seater rooms with all the basic amenities.
Faculty: All the professors who taught us are very helpful and well-qualified from great institutions like NITs. The way they taught us is excellent. The course curriculum is very relevant for us, it makes the students industry-ready, especially because of the T&P classes that they started from the 1st semester. The semester exams are average, not too difficult, about moderate.
Other: As I want to do something in AI and with my low JEE percentile, i.e., 80 percentile, I did not get the top colleges, so I decided to join a college that is decent in placement and tuition fees, and this college is one of them. About scholarships, if you have good marks in 12th (85 percent+), then you get a scholarship of about 10k per year, and you can also opt for your domicile state scholarship and private scholarships.

Placement is good for marketing students.
Placements: For marketing students, the college is quite good. For the batch 2023–25, the highest placement is around 12–13 LPA, while the average package is approximately 4–4.5 LPA, and the lowest is 2.5–3 LPA. For other specialisations like Finance, HR, and IB, fewer companies visit the campus.
Infrastructure: Infrastructure is good, and now digital classrooms are there in every classroom. Projectors are available, and a library is also in the IBMR department where you can find books related to MBA. The college also has a canteen and good parking space for both two-wheelers and four-wheelers.
Faculty: Teachers are qualified, and most teachers are Ph.D. degree holders and experienced. Teachers are very friendly and support you whenever needed during the journey. They also help in package practice and placement training conducted by the college for students, in which teachers help a lot.
Other: MBA is a PG degree meant for uplifting the future and for a better career. Any student from any field can do MBA. In my batch, there are a few students whose background is not commerce, but still, they have done great work.

Best college in central India, if your budget is tight and you want to study well.
Placements: Placement is very good in the year 2025. All the branches have good placement except civil. CSE has 80 percent placement, and mechanical has 70 percent, and mechatronic has 85% percent rate in civil. 13 students are placed, 8 get placed in KPIL, and 4 are in rooms.
Infrastructure: Hostel is good at cheap price. It provides very good facilities for only 1300 rupees per year. Mess fee is Rs 2500 per month. Hostel is good, and especially girls hostel is very good. It provides very nice facility at a very cheap price that no one else provides.
Faculty: Faculty members are nice. They help each time but some of them are very rude. They don't give you a number for how much you write in exam but most of them are nice. They try to help you in every situation and every moment of your B.Tech journey. They guide you and help you in your placement journey.
Other: Total fees of college are only 1 lakh for 4 year and for SC, ST its free. They provide you placements, internships, and all other facilities. Even for SC and ST students, they provide you with stationery and even they give a scholarship, and if your rank is below 1.5 lakhs in JEE then also general category student fees are free.

Q: Β  Is RGPV a private or government college?
A: 

Rajiv Gandhi Proudyogiki Vishwavidyalaya is a government college. RGPV was established in 1988 by the Government of Madhya Pradesh. RGPV Bhopal is recognised by UGC and accredited with an A grade by NAAC. RGPV offers over 50 courses at the Diploma, UG, PG and PhD levels in various streams, such as Management, Science, Engineering and Pharmacy. The courses are offered under 8 departments at the university. Out of all the courses, the University is popularly known for BTech, MBA, BDes and Diploma programmes.

Q: Β  Why is RGPV Bhopal so famous?
A: 

RGPV Bhopal University is a well-know goverment university which is recognised by the UGC and is accredited with an 'A' grade by the NAAC.  Rajiv Gandhi Proudyogiki Vishwavidyalaya Bhopal is a multi-campus affiliating, research university that is also a member of the Association of Indian Universities (AIU). There are 5 teaching institutions,  200 affiliated Engineering colleges,  95+ Pharmacy colleges,  90+ MCA colleges, and 4 Architecture colleges imparting various courses.

Q: Β  How is the library at RGPV?
A: 

The central library at RGPV was established in 1998. The library has a wide range of Engineering, Technology and Science resources. It includes about 71935 books, 150 Printed Journals, 09 publishers International journals, more than 20000 National and International Periodicals, 21 National and Local News Paper in English and Hindi, 25000 Project Reports, and 450 Bound Professional Journals.

Q: Β  What is the seat intake for BTech at RGPV?
A: 

RGPV offers a full-time BTech course via its various affiliated colleges. The total seat intake for BTech among all the affiliated colleges is 55,980. Find below the seat intake bifurcation for BTech in the top affiliated colleges of RGPV:

Affiliated CollegesSeat Intake
University Institute of Technology, Bhopal - Rajiv Gandhi Proudyogiki Vishwavidyalay1680
Madhav Institute of Technology and Science1278
IPS Academy1200
Millennium Group of Institution852
